A Cross Roads man faces 25 years to life in prison after confessing to continually sexually assaulting a juvenile over several years, according to Henderson County Sheriff Botie Hillhouse.
William Eugene Hesseltine, 58, confessed to the crime Thursday after questioning, according to a news release from the sheriff’s office.
When the victim was interviewed by investigators, she made an appeal for help. After he was contacted by authorities, Hesseltine told them he knew why they were speaking with him, the release stated.
